355 with or with out F1 drive?

If you were getting a 355 would you get with or with out F1 drive?

I had a 95 F355b and the 6speed is the way to go. They feel notchy when shifted slow but have a great feel when shifted hard. I've driven the 355 with a F1 and it was brutal every time it shifted . I guess the f1s in the 360 and the CSs are better. Also the F1s tend to eat clutches. carl
